      <description>&lt;P&gt;I have been using AutoCad for many years since version 12. The last version I acquired was AutoCad 2006 which I purchased many years ago. I have been using it ever since. I got a new computer and installed Autocad on it more than a year ago and have been using AutoCad on it. Last week I was using it and all of a sudden it says that I needed to register it. In fact when I first installed it, I provided the serial number and the activation code that I have. Three days from the day it asked me to register my AutoCad stop running. When I restart it, it requests the activation code and&amp;nbsp;when I enter the activation code, I get an error message and the software asks me to contact Autodesk which is impossible because there Is no number through which one can reach a human being at Autodesk. &amp;nbsp;When I access the Autodesk site and go through support I come to a dead end at which point I am told this version is not supported. So now I have a software that I fully own and cannot run it because Autodesk locked it. I contacted Autodesk through emails no answer. I tried twitter and was asked to come to this forum. I hope someone can help.&amp;nbsp;&lt;BR /&gt;Any help will be very appreciated.&amp;nbsp;&lt;BR /&gt;Thank you.&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;autodesk stopped generating activation codes for versions 2010 &amp;amp; lower on August 31, 2019&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;nothing Autodesk is going to do &am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;you can subscribe to a newer version or dump Autodesk &amp;amp; switch to a competitor&lt;/P&gt;</description>

&lt;P&gt;you get an AutoCAD license with a serial number, this number stays the same as long as the product is valid.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;After installing the software you are asked for an activation code (as long as online activation did not work) and that is created by Autodesk, depending on serial number as well as on operating system and hardware. So if you change the hardware or you install a new operating system you need a new activation code delivered from Autodesk.&lt;/P&gt;

      <description>&lt;BLOCKQUOTE&gt;&lt;HR /&gt;@Anonymous&amp;nbsp;wrote:&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;DIV class="mceNonEditable lia-copypaste-placeholder"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;P&gt;I really do not need support I just need my software to start and not be interfered with remotely by Autodesk.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;HR /&gt;&lt;/BLOCKQUOTE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Autodesk is not remotely interfering. Your software can need to be re-activated for a number of reasons. The only thing Autodesk is doing is not reactivating your old software. No remote interference at all. Once you get it up and running you need to prevent anything from happening to your system that would require the software to be reactivated. That is why it needs to be disconnected from all outside influences.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Good luck!&lt;/P&gt;</description>
